NeuroSense Granted South Korean Patent for PrimeC ALS Drug
AI Summary
NeuroSense Therapeutics Ltd. announced it has been granted a South Korean patent (No. 10-2969898) covering the composition of PrimeC, its lead drug candidate for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S). The patent claims cover PrimeC's proprietary formulation, manufacturing process, and pharmaceutical use for ALS, providing protection in South Korea through 2042. This milestone expands NeuroSense's global intellectual property portfolio and supports its long-term development and commercialization strategy as the company prepares to initiate its pivotal Phase 3 PARAGON study for PrimeC.
